Abstract
The fabrication and characterization of PV modules are always done under standard test conditions (STC). However, the condition of operation are often far from this standard conditions. As a result, developing a characterization circuit is considered as a point of interest for researchers. This paper presents a new methodology in characterizing a PV module using an electronic load circuit. The circuit is implemented using a power MOSFET driven by a pulse width modulator (PWM) developed by LABVIEW. The system is tested and its results are validated by comparing it with simulation results performed by Comsol Multiphysics and Matlab. The system shows high accuracy with respect to the previous published work with lower cost and higher simplicity Keywords— Photovoltaic, Characterization, Electronic load, and Pulse width modulation (PWM
